Understanding Adult Psychiatry

Before delving into how to find a psychiatrist, it is important to comprehend what adult psychiatry incorporates. Adult psychiatrists are medical doctors focused on mental health, trained to identify and treat a broad variety of conditions including:

  • Anxiety disorders: Generalized Anxiety Disorder, Panic Disorder, Social Anxiety Disorder
  • State of mind disorders: Major Depressive Disorder, Bipolar Disorder
  • Psychotic disorders: Schizophrenia, Schizoaffective Disorder
  • Personality conditions: Borderline Personality Disorder, Antisocial Personality Disorder
  • Substance-related conditions: Addiction, Substance Use Disorder

Adult psychiatrists use different treatment approaches, consisting of medication management, therapy (such as cognitive-behavioral treatment), and other interventions like lifestyle modifications and connected care with other doctor.

Elements to Consider When Choosing an Adult Psychiatrist

Discovering the ideal psychiatrist can make a significant distinction in treatment results. Here are necessary aspects to consider:

1. Qualifications and Credentials

  • Medical degree from a certified organization
  • Board accreditation in psychiatry
  • Additional certifications in subspecialties, if needed

2. Experience and Specialization

  • Years of practice
  • Specific locations of competence (e.g., state of mind conditions, geriatric psychiatry)

3. Communication Style

  • Approachability and desire to listen
  • Compatibility with patient's choices (e.g., direct vs. relational interaction)

4. Treatment Philosophy

  • Preference for medication, treatment, or a combination
  • Holistic vs. standard treatment techniques

5. Area and Availability

  • Proximity to home or workplace
  • Flexibility of visit times (including nights or weekends)

6. Insurance coverage Coverage

  • Approval of insurance coverage plans or payment alternatives
  • Out-of-pocket expenses and session costs

7. Reviews and Recommendations

  • Reviews from previous patients
  • Recommendations from relied on health care specialists or buddies

8. Cultural Competence

  • Awareness and respect for cultural, spiritual, or lifestyle distinctions
  • Capability to provide personalized care based upon private backgrounds

How to Find an Adult Psychiatrist Near You

Discovering a psychiatrist doesn't have to be frustrating. Below are steps to assist in your search:

Step 1: Leverage Online Resources

  • Psychiatry Associations: Websites like the American Psychiatric Association deal directory sites of signed up specialists.
  • Insurance coverage Provider: Many insurance provider keep lists of in-network suppliers.
  • Health Platforms: Websites like Healthgrades, Zocdoc, or Psychology Today provide searchable databases, consisting of client reviews.

Action 2: Seek Recommendations

  • Reach out to your main care physician for recommendations.
  • Ask good friends or household who may have experience with mental health experts.
  • Join regional assistance groups and ask members for their recommendations.

Action 3: Narrow Your Options

  • Develop a list of possible psychiatrists, noting their credentials, specializeds, and places.
  • Think about preliminary assessments to assess relationship and comfort.

Step 4: Schedule Consultations

  • Contact shortlisted psychiatrists to ask for an initial conference.
  • Talk about treatment approaches, methods, and fees.

Step 5: Review and Decide

  • Evaluate how you felt during consultations.
  • Choose somebody you are comfy with and who understands your requirements.

FAQ about Adult Psychiatrists

1. What is the difference in between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?

Psychiatrists are medical doctors who can prescribe medication and offer treatment, while psychologists mostly offer treatment however can not recommend medications.

2. How do I know if I need to see a psychiatrist?

If you are experiencing prolonged sensations of anxiety, depression, state of mind swings, or any behavior that affects your life, it may be advantageous to speak with a psychiatrist.

3. Will my psychiatrist prescribe medication?

Lots of psychiatrists incorporate medication management into their treatment plans, depending upon the client's requirements. However, some might focus solely on treatment.

4. What should I anticipate throughout my very first visit?

During the preliminary see, the psychiatrist will discuss your case history, existing signs, and treatment choices. Be prepared to respond to questions about your way of life, family history, and previous treatments.

5. How frequently will I require to see a psychiatrist?

The frequency of visits can differ based on the person's condition and treatment strategy; some may need weekly check outs, while others may see their psychiatrist month-to-month or as required.
